Once the birds and their nesting materials are gone, our job is far from over. We focus on providing a complete solution to address the aftermath and prevent future issues. Bird infestations can lead to several serious problems:

  • Fire Hazards & Ventilation Blockages: Nests, particularly in dryer vents, can severely obstruct airflow, creating a serious fire risk due to lint buildup. Blocked vents in bathrooms or kitchens can also lead to poor air quality and moisture damage.
  • Health Risks from Contamination: Bird droppings can harbour harmful bacteria and fungi (e.g., Histoplasmosis, Salmonella), which can become airborne and pose significant health risks to your family.
  • Nesting Debris & Secondary Pests: The twigs, grass, and feathers used in nests can attract insects, mites, and other pests, creating additional problems.
  • Structural & Insulation Damage: Birds may tear at insulation for nesting material, and their acidic droppings can corrode building components over time.

Our comprehensive service includes thoroughly cleaning and sanitizing all affected areas to remove contaminants. We then identify and seal all potential entry points and install durable, bird-proof vent covers and other exclusion devices to ensure birds cannot re-enter.
